Some of the most useful signals about where aesthetic surgery consultations are heading come from decision science, consumer psychology, and technology adoption research that wasn&#8217;t even conducted specifically about plastic surgery \u2014 but applies directly to it. Here are five patterns worth understanding, and what each one implies for how you run consultations.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\">1. 100 milliseconds \u2014 how fast a first impression forms<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">Willis and Todorov&#8217;s widely cited social cognition research found that people form trait judgments from a face in as little as 100 milliseconds of exposure. Applied to consultations: the <em>quality<\/em> of the very first visual reference a patient sees \u2014 sharp and personalized versus vague and generic \u2014 sets an emotional anchor almost instantly, well before any verbal explanation has a chance to shape the conversation.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\"><strong>Implication:<\/strong> Introduce Arbrea visualization early in the consultation, not as a closing tool.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\">2. Five adopter categories \u2014 and only two of them capture a marketing advantage<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">Everett Rogers&#8217; diffusion of innovations model splits technology adoption into innovators, early adopters, early majority, late majority, and laggards. Historically, across every industry this framework has been applied to, only the first two categories capture meaningful differentiation value from being early \u2014 by the time a technology reaches &#8220;early majority&#8221; adoption, it has typically become a baseline expectation rather than a competitive edge.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\"><strong>Implication:<\/strong> Whether 3D simulation technology is a differentiator or a requirement in your specific local market depends entirely on how many of your competitors have already adopted it \u2014 worth actually checking, not assuming.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\">3. One dominant predictor of dissatisfaction \u2014 expectation mismatch<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">Across the cosmetic surgery psychology literature (Sarwer &amp; Crerand; Honigman, Phillips &amp; Castle, among others), mismatch between expected and actual outcome is repeatedly identified as one of the strongest predictors of patient dissatisfaction \u2014 independent of technical surgical quality. This single finding is arguably the most important one in this entire list, because it means satisfaction is, in part, a <em>communication<\/em> outcome, not only a <em>surgical<\/em> outcome.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\"><strong>Implication:<\/strong> Any tool that improves the accuracy of pre-operative expectations is not just a marketing nicety \u2014 it is functioning as a genuine clinical-outcome lever.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\"><img decoding=\"async\" class=\"aligncenter wp-image-57723 size-large lazyload\" src=\"data:image\/gif;base64,R0lGODlhAQABAAAAACH5BAEKAAEALAAAAAABAAEAAAICTAEAOw==\" alt=\"research-infographic\" width=\"1024\" height=\"576\" sizes=\"(max-width: 1024px) 100vw, 1024px\" data-src=\"https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-1024x576.png\" data-srcset=\"https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-1024x576.png 1024w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-300x169.png 300w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-768x432.png 768w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-1536x864.png 1536w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-2048x1152.png 2048w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-18x10.png 18w, https:\/\/arbrea-labs.com\/wp-content\/uploads\/2026\/08\/research-infographic-360x203.png 360w\">4. Zero \u2014 the number of comparison photos that are anatomically identical to your patient<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">Social comparison research (Festinger&#8217;s foundational work and its many extensions) establishes that comparison accuracy depends on similarity between the person and the comparison target. No before\/after gallery photo, however impressive, has your specific patient&#8217;s bone structure, skin quality, or baseline anatomy. That&#8217;s not a critique of before\/after galleries \u2014 they remain useful for demonstrating range and style \u2014 but it does mean they are structurally incapable of solving the personalization problem on their own.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\"><strong>Implication:<\/strong> Personalized, patient-specific simulation and general-portfolio galleries solve two different problems; strong consultations use both, deliberately.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\">5. One consistent finding \u2014 active participation beats passive viewing<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">Commitment and consistency research in behavioral psychology (Cialdini and the broader decision-ownership literature) consistently finds that people who actively participate in shaping a decision \u2014 rather than passively receiving information about it \u2014 report stronger follow-through and lower post-decision regret. An interactive 3D simulation session, where the patient adjusts and explores their own avatar, is a participation format; a static image or verbal description is not.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\"><strong>Implication:<\/strong> Interactivity, not just visual realism, is the feature most closely tied to decision follow-through.<\/p>\n<h2 class=\"mt-3 -mb-1 text-[1.125rem] font-bold\" dir=\"ltr\">Putting the Pattern Together<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al\" dir=\"ltr\">None of these five findings were discovered in an aesthetic surgery context specifically \u2014 they come from decision science, social cognition, and consumer psychology research spanning decades.
